In terms of conversion costs, however, the 1,000 sheets of plywood are only 60% complete, so they are the equivalent of 600 completed sheets in terms of accumulating costs. Therefore, in terms of direct materials, the 1,000 sheets of plywood are 100% complete because all the logs came in at the beginning of the process.

Equivalent units are calculated by multiply the number of physical units in work in process by the estimated percentage of completion of the units. In reconciling total units into production with the total units transferred out/still in process, it is not uncommon for there to be a shortfall. The reason is that many processes may involve scrap, waste, or spoilage (e.g., evaporation, spilling, etc.). Waste and spoilage would be added as a third component needed to balance the lower portion of the quantity schedule column. EUP calculates the number of completed units that could have been produced from the work in progress during a given period. It considers partially completed units of production and estimates how many fully completed units could have been produced based on the degree of completion of each unit. Under this method opening work-in-progress is stated in equivalent completed units by applying the percentage of work needed to complete the unfinished work of the previous period. Then number of units started and completed (i.e. units started less closing stock) are added. Further equivalent completed units of closing work-in-progress are also added to get the equivalent production.
